- Mahyar NikpourJan 12, 2024 · 2 years agoOne commonly used candlestick pattern to indicate a bullish trend in crypto markets is the 'bullish engulfing' pattern. This pattern occurs when a small bearish candle is followed by a larger bullish candle that completely engulfs the previous candle. It suggests that buyers have taken control and the price may continue to rise. Another pattern is the 'hammer' pattern, which has a small body and a long lower shadow. It indicates that sellers were initially in control but buyers stepped in and pushed the price back up, signaling a potential bullish reversal. On the other hand, a 'bearish engulfing' pattern is often used to indicate a bearish trend. It is the opposite of the bullish engulfing pattern, where a small bullish candle is followed by a larger bearish candle that engulfs the previous candle. This suggests that sellers have taken control and the price may continue to decline. These are just a few examples of candlestick patterns used to identify bullish or bearish trends in crypto markets. It's important to note that no pattern is foolproof and should be used in conjunction with other technical analysis tools for more accurate predictions.
